Kit Harington and Rose Leslie Are Expecting Their First Child
Game of Thrones actors Kit Harington and Rose Leslie are expecting their first child.
Kit Harington and Rose Leslie are officially growing their family. That's right: The Game of Thrones actors are expecting their first child together.
Leslie made the news official, debuting her baby bump for the new issue of the U.K.'s Make Magazine.

Leslie and Harington have been spending most of their time lately in their gorgeous Tudor manor house in East Anglia, which Leslie jokingly referred to in her Make interview as "the house that Jon Snow built."
It's an appropriate joke for couple, who met on the set of HBO's hit fantasy epic, Game of Thrones, on which they played star-crossed lovers Jon Snow and Ygritte.
The actors fell for each other off camera, too, and were first reported to be dating IRL in 2012. They split up briefly, but got back together and eventually (finally) confirmed their real-life love connection in April 2016. By September 2017, Leslie and Harington had announced their engagement (with an 0ld-fashioned newspaper ad in the The Times, adorably). They tied the knot in a very Game of Thrones-appropriate way—in a lavish ceremony at a castle in Scotland in June 2019.
